A used Toyota Tundra side mirror (chrome, w/o turn signal; w/o blind spot alert; RH) costs $25 to $298, with a median asking price of $171. Based on 145 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 9,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

Trim-specific context
This pricing covers the chrome, w/o turn signal; w/o blind spot alert; RH variant of the Toyota Tundra side mirror, based on 145 priced listings across 4 model years (2018, 2019, 2020, 2021). Its $171 median is 23% below the Toyota Tundra side mirror overall median of $221.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
